      <study_design>Randomization: Randomized, Blinding: Double blinded, Placebo: Not used, Assignment: Parallel, Purpose: Supportive, Other design features: The samples were randomly placed in two groups.&#13;
If the first sample is girl, the sample placed in intervention group and after the samples alternative (one to one) placed in control and intervention groups and if the first sample is boy, the sample placed in control group and after the samples alternative (one to one) placed in intervention and control groups.</study_design>

      <i_freetext>Intervention 1: Intervention groups: The samples of intervention group training at 3 sessions of 40 minutes in the form of lectures, group discussions and practical view.&#13;
Educational content classes includes:&#13;
First session: raising awareness and attitude,&#13;
Second session: the importance of perceived behavioral control on empowerment&#13;
And third Session: Practical showing the correct way of brushing and flossing and practice on themselves. Intervention 2: Control group: samples of the control group as well as samples of the intervention group (without participation in the educational classes) to complete the questionnaires.</i_freetext>

      <inclusion_criteria>Inclusion criteria: willingness to participate in the study; fourth to sixth primary school students; without learning disorders such as ADHD and autism; without attending similar training.&#13;
Exclusion criteria: reluctance to continue to participate in the study; school managers opposing to participate of students in the study; reluctance of parents to participate of students in the study; irregular participation in training classes.</inclusion_criteria>

      <prim_outcome>Observance of mouth and tooth health. Timepoint: The questionnaire immediately after the intervention and one month after it is completed by samples of two experimental and control groups. Method of measurement: The seven-part questionnaire including: knowledge, attitude, subjective norm, perceived behavioral control, intention and behavior.</prim_outcome>
